Windows 2012 에서 SQLServer 2014 alway son 의 그림 을 설정 합 니 다.

SQLserver 2014 AlwaysOn 은 기 존의 데이터베이스 미 러 기능 을 강화 하여 이전의 단일 데이터베이스 고장 전 이 를 그룹(여러 데이터)단위 의 고장 전이 로 만 들 었 다.9 개의 복사 파트너,가 독성 보조 던 전 서버 등 다양한 기능 을 지원 할 수 있다.그룹 단위 의 데이터 베 이 스 는 주로 응용 이 여러 데이터 베이스 간 에 존재 하 는 의존성 을 해결 하여 전체적인 이전 을 하 는 것 이다.그 다음 에 그 보고서 나 읽 기 전용 수 요 를 보조 복사 본 으로 옮 겨 서 메 인 복사 본의 부 하 를 크게 줄 이 고 메 인 복사 본 을 더욱 쉽게 확장 시 키 며 생산 부 하 를 더욱 잘 지원 하고 요청 에 더욱 빠 른 응답 을 제공 할 수 있다.
본 고 는 가상 환경 Windows 2012+SQLserver 2014 AlwaysOn 설정 과정 을 묘사 했다.
1.환경 설정 설명

<code class="hljs scss">  Vmware workstation 12,4    ,      ,3 SQL  ,  NAT  ,  DHCP 
       ,   2    AlwaysOn, SQLnode1,SQLnode2 
     IP GateWay DNS
SQLDC 192.168.171.20 192.168.171.2 127.0.0.1
SQLnode1( ) 192.168.171.21 192.168.171.2 192.168.171.20
SQLnode2( ) 192.168.171.22 192.168.171.2 192.168.171.20
SQLnode3( ) 192.168.171.23 192.168.171.2 192.168.171.20
AlwaysOnWSFC 192.168.171.18 
</code>
2.AlwaysOn 설정 전제

<code class="hljs scss"> [  Windows 2012  (For SQLServer 2014 AlwaysOn)](http://blog.csdn.net/leshami/article/details/51180359)
[Windows 2012      (For SQLServer 2014 AlwaysOn)](http://blog.csdn.net/leshami/article/details/51218021)
[  SQLserver 2014(For AlwaysOn)](http://blog.csdn.net/leshami/article/details/51224954)
</code>
3.AlwaysOn 오픈
1)계 정과 sqlserver 시작 하기(2 노드)
2 노드 가 도 메 인 사용자 계 정 을 사용 하여 시작 하도록 확보 합 니 다.
 
2)AlwaysOn 사용 가능 한 그룹 사용 하기(2 노드)
SQLserver 설정 관리 자 를 열 고 SQLserver 서 비 스 를 찾 습 니 다.AlwaysOn 사용 가능 한 그룹 을 선택 하 십시오.

3)SQLserver 를 다시 시작 하면 AlwaysOn 이 적 용 됩 니 다(2 노드)

4)AlwaysOn 오픈 검증(2 노드)
SQLserver 서버 에서 속성 을 선택 하려 면 오른쪽 단 추 를 누 르 십시오.HADR 을 True 로 사용 하면 AlwaysOn 이 유효 합 니 다.

5)메 인 노드 에 프레젠테이션 라 이브 러 리 및 테이블 만 들 기

<code class="hljs scss"><code class="hljs sql">        SQLnode1,      
CREATE DATABASE AlwaysonDB1; 
GO 
CREATE DATABASE AlwaysonDB2; 
GO 
USE AlwaysonDB1; 
GO 
CREATE TABLE t1 (id INT ,dbname VARCHAR(20)); 
INSERT INTO t1 VALUES ( 1, 'AlwaysonDB1' ); 
USE AlwaysonDB2; 
CREATE TABLE t2 (id INT ,dbname VARCHAR(20)); 
INSERT INTO t2 VALUES ( 1, 'AlwaysonDB2' ); </code></code>
6)공유 폴 더 를 만 들 고 백업 및 보조 노드 를 저장 하여 백업 을 읽 습 니 다.
다음 그림 에서 공유 폴 더 를 만 들 었 습 니 다.

7)공유 폴 더 에 적합 한 권한 할당

8.백업 데이터베이스

       ,          SQLserver       
backup database AlwaysonDB1 to disk='C:\AlwaysonBAK\AlwaysonDB1.BAK';
backup database AlwaysonDB2 to disk='C:\AlwaysonBAK\AlwaysonDB2.BAK';
4.AlwaysOn 사용 가능 한 그룹 설정
1)사용 가능 한 그룹 마법사 사용,다음 그림

<�"https://www.jb51.net/kf/ware/vc/" target="_blank" class="keylink">vcD4NCjxwPjxjb2RlIGNsYXNzPQ=="hljs scss">2)        

3)사용 가능 한 그룹 을 위해 데이터 베 이 스 를 선택 합 니 다.즉,어떤 데이터 베 이 스 를 현재 사용 가능 한 그룹 으로 선택 합 니까?

4)보조 노드 추가

5)이전 모드 및 제출 모드 설정,읽 기 가능 등
관련 옵션 항목 에 대한 설명 이 있 으 니 참고 하 시기 바 랍 니 다.던 전 모드 등

6)점 설정,결 성 유지
이 곳 의 점 설정 은 데이터베이스 미 러 의 점 과 같 습 니 다.

7)백업 옵션
그 복사 본 을 우선 백업 할 수 있 는 권한 을 설정 하 는 데 사 용 됩 니 다.
디텍터 설정 을 무시 하고 추 후 설정 할 수 있 습 니 다.

8)데이터 동기 화 방식 선택
전체 동기 화 를 선택 하 였 습 니 다.즉,SQLserver 는 자동 으로 백업 하고 보조 복사 본 에서 복원 합 니 다.

9)설정 검증

10)요약 정보

11)AlwaysOn 사용 가능 한 그룹 구축 시작

12)구축 완료

13)가용성 그룹 검증
노드 1 아래 그림 참조

노드 2 는 다음 그림 과 같 습 니 다.2 개의 데이터 베 이 스 는 동기 화 되 었 습 니 다.

14)가용성 그룹 관리 패 널
오른쪽 단 추 를 누 르 면 AlwaysOn 사용 가능성 이 높 습 니 다.디 스 플레이 패 널 을 선택 하 십시오.
 
5.테스트 AlwaysOn 고장 이전
1)사용 가능 한 그룹 선택,오른쪽 클릭,고장 이전 선택
 
2)고장 이전 마법사

3)새 주 던 전 선택

4)던 전 접속

5)이전 요약 정보

6)고장 전이 시작

7)이전 결과 검증

8)자동 고장 전이 테스트
현재 읽 기와 쓰기 노드 는 SQLNODE 2 입 니 다.SQLNODE 2 sqlserver 서 비 스 를 다시 시작 하면 사용 가능 한 그룹 은 자동 으로 SQLNODE 1 로 이동 합 니 다.캡 처 전략.

좋은 웹페이지 즐겨찾기